Mayflower MRT Station (TE6) is a future underground Mass Rapid Transit station on the Thomson-East Coast LineinAng Mo Kio planning area, Singapore, along Ang Mo Kio Avenue 4.

It will be located around Kebun Baru Heights Estate, Kebun Baru Community Centre (CC) and near CHIJ St Nicholas Girls' School.[1]

History

This station was first announced on 29 August 2012.[2] It will have the most number of exits along the Thomson-East Coast Line, with seven, making it the most accessible.[3] The station is being constructed by Hong Kong-based construction firm, Gammon Construction Limited.
